Worldwide Howl at the Moon Night
On Worldwide Howl at the Moon Night, join in on a global chorus of howls and embrace your inner wild spirit!
Introduction
It's time to let out your wild side and join in on the fun of Worldwide Howl at the Moon Night on October 26! This unique day was created to celebrate the connection between humans and nature, and is a way for people to connect with their inner animal. According to folklore, howling at the moon can bring about good fortune, so why not take this opportunity to make a wish or two? Whether you're alone or with a group of friends, there's no better way to spend this night than by howling at the moon!

How to Celebrate Worldwide Howl at the Moon Night
1
Host a howl night
Gather your friends and family and host a howl night. Have everyone dress up in their favorite animal costumes and howl along to their favorite tunes.
2
Attend a concert
Find a nearby concert and attend! Listen to some live music and howl along with the crowd.
3
Go stargazing
Pack up a blanket and head out to find a spot to see some stars. Take in the night sky, and howl at the moon for extra fun.
4
Bake moon pies
Make some moon pies with your favorite cookie dough recipe and decorate them with crescent moons, stars, and clouds. Let the kids help out and enjoy an evening of baking together.
5
Camp out
Pitch a tent in your backyard or head out to the woods and camp out under the stars. Enjoy telling stories, making s’mores, and of course don’t forget to howl at the moon!
